بغث

Root entry · 7 derived lemmas

This root primarily relates to birds, specifically a type of bird and its characteristics, and by extension, to things that are inferior, mixed, or common. It also extends to descriptions of color and location.

Parallel reading

البغاث: طائر أبغث إلى الغبرة، دوين الرخمة بطئ الطيران.
Al-Bagath: a bird that is grayish, smaller than a vulture, and slow in flight.
إن البغاث بأرضنا يستنسر
Indeed, the common birds in our land act like eagles.
أي من جاورنا عز بنا.
Meaning, whoever neighbors us gains strength through us.
فمن جعل البغاث واحدا فجمعه بغثان، مثل غزال وغزلان.
And whoever considers 'al-bagath' as singular, its plural is 'baghathan', like 'ghazal' and 'ghizlan'.
ومن قال للذكر والانثى بغاثة فالجمع بغاث، مثل نعامة ونعام.
And whoever calls the male and female 'bagatha', its plural is 'bagath', like 'na'amah' and 'na'am'.
بغاث الطير: شرارها وما لا يصيد منها.
The inferior birds: their worst ones and those that are not hunted.
والأبغث قريب من الأغبر.
And 'al-abghath' is close to 'al-aghbar' (dusty/ash-colored).
والأبغث: مكان ذو رمل.
And 'al-abghath': a place with sand.
والبغثاء من الغنم: مثل الرقطاء.
And 'al-baghtha' from the sheep: like the spotted one.
والبغثاء: أخلاط الناس، يقال: دخلنا في البغثاء، أي في عامة الناس وجماعتهم.
And 'al-baghtha': mixtures of people. It is said: 'We entered into al-baghtha', meaning into the common people and their assembly.
